site stats

Fetch api redirect manual

WebIf it is "manual", fetch() API doesn't follow the redirect and returns an opaque-redirect filtered response which wraps the redirect response. Since you want to redirect after a fetch just use it as fetch(url, { method: 'POST', redirect: 'follow'}) .then(response => { // HTTP 301 response }) .catch(function(err) { console.info(err + " url ... WebApr 11, 2024 · /api/users/authenticate - POST - public route for authenticating username and password and generating a JWT token. /api/users/register - POST - public route for registering a new user with the Next.js app. /api/users - GET - secure route that returns all users. /api/users/[id] - GET - secure route that returns the user with the specified id.

fetch() global function - Web APIs MDN - Mozilla

Web{ // These properties are part of the Fetch Standard method: 'GET', headers: {}, // request headers. format is the identical to that accepted by the Headers constructor (see below) body: null, // request body. can be null, a string, a Buffer, a Blob, or a Node.js Readable stream redirect: 'follow', // set to `manual` to extract redirect headers ... WebNov 15, 2024 · HttpClientHandler.AllowAutoRedirect Property should work on the Blazor WASM platform and the following code should set the redirect parameter to manual on the Fetch Api: And the response should return with status code 301 with the location header set as it does in the F12 dev tools. new HttpClientHandler { AllowAutoRedirect = false } proviso partners for health https://youin-ele.com

[Solved]-redirect after a fetch post call-Reactjs

WebApr 3, 2024 · The Fetch API provides a JavaScript interface for accessing and manipulating parts of the protocol, such as requests and responses. It also provides a global fetch() … WebInterface: Body. Body is an abstract interface with methods that are applicable to both Request and Response classes.. body.body (deviation from spec) Node.js Readable stream; Data are encapsulated in the Body object. Note that while the Fetch Standard requires the property to always be a WHATWG ReadableStream, in node-fetch it is a Node.js … WebApr 8, 2024 · The fetch () method is controlled by the connect-src directive of Content Security Policy rather than the directive of the resources it's retrieving. Note: The fetch () method's parameters are identical to those of the Request () constructor. Syntax fetch(resource) fetch(resource, options) Parameters resource proviso pathways

Safari, the Fetch API, and 30X redirects - Medium

Category:Request: redirect property - Web APIs MDN - Mozilla

Tags:Fetch api redirect manual

Fetch api redirect manual

How to redirect the user to a different page when using fetch …

WebApr 3, 2024 · Using the Fetch API The Fetch API provides a JavaScript interface for accessing and manipulating parts of the protocol, such as requests and responses. It also provides a global fetch () method that provides an easy, logical way to fetch resources asynchronously across the network. WebApr 7, 2024 · manual If not specified when the request is created, it takes the default value of follow. Examples In the following snippet, we create a new request using the Request () constructor (for an image file in the same directory as the script), then save the request redirect value in a variable:

Fetch api redirect manual

Did you know?

WebOct 31, 2024 · That request returns a 307 code with a pre-signed url to Amazon S3. The request to Amazon fails because it contains the Authorization header I sent to my API in the initial request, and it should't be there. I need to be able to remove it after my API returns the 307 but before the request to Amazon is made. From what I've gathered, the browser ... WebFeb 2, 2024 · I have been trying to redirect the user to a different page after a POST call to my site api with fetch and await. I am receiving a response which says GET localhost:10004/ page. Usually in $.ajax or xmlHTTPRequest it redirects automatically but when using the new fetch and await syntax it fails to redirect automatically. Here is my …

WebApr 7, 2024 · Detecting redirects. Checking to see if the response comes from a redirected request is as simple as checking this flag on the Response object. In the code below, a … WebJun 24, 2024 · 1. The Response object has an undocumented url property. So, let's say you call. const response = await fetch (url, { redirect: 'follow', follow: 10, }); response.url will be the URL of the last redirect that was followed. Share. Improve this answer. Follow. answered Mar 23, 2024 at 22:13.

WebJun 25, 2024 · Create a fetch Request object with your URL and request options. Set the request’s Request.redirect property to “manual”, or browsers will default to “follow”. Pass your custom Request object into your fetch. This will prevent Safari from being a real bastard about automatically following things it shouldn’t follow. WebJun 17, 2015 · Step 2.1: ask SW for a response, get an opaque redirect back. Because this is an opaque redirect & not a client request context, set skip-service-worker flag Step 4.301.10: follow the redirect, without consulting the SW Step 2.1: ask SW for a response, get an opaque redirect back.

WebSep 21, 2024 · manual will return the URL of the redirect, and the redirect attribute of the response will be true. As it suggests, allows you to manually handle the redirect. referrerPolicy referrerPolicy / referrer will determine how your request handles it’s ‘referrer’ header. This is usually set to the URL that made the request.

WebOct 12, 2024 · "manual" – allows to process HTTP-redirects manually. In case of redirect, we’ll get a special response object, with response.type="opaqueredirect" and … proviso missionary baptist churchWebJan 29, 2024 · I am writing code for a web application that send a POST request to node.js server using fetch() api of javascript. On successful request server responds with a redirection, this redirection url is received in the fetch() api response body. After this what should I do to redirect user to this URL from fetch function. provis online portalrestaurants near christown mallWebThe HTML spec requires browsers to first set the redirect mode to manual when the browser starts navigating to a resource. That’s the only use in any spec for the manual redirect mode. But because the Fetch API essentially exposes the same primitives that browsers use internally for fetches, it exposes a manual redirect mode. restaurants near christopher streetWebSep 1, 2024 · It’s worth noting: to just detect if there’s been a redirect, you actually don’t even need to check that. That’s the easiest way to check, but you could also just check response .url, and if that’s different from the request URL you gave to the fetch (…) call, you know it was redirected. restaurants near chiswick houseWebJun 25, 2024 · Create a fetch Request object with your URL and request options. Set the request’s Request.redirect property to “manual”, or browsers will default to “follow”. … restaurants near christown spectrum mallWebJul 28, 2024 · only with fetch I'm able to not follow the redirect, however I'm not able to retrieve the response headers (empty object). For all af these implementations, from the console network browser, I can see the 302 request made correctly and the response headers retrieved. provisons from the ocean